Luxurious Amenities
The Hilton Garden Inn San Antonio/Rim Pass Drive offers a range of luxurious amenities for guests to enjoy, including an outdoor pool and a fitness centre. Each room is equipped with modern conveniences such as air conditioning, a microwave, refrigerator, and coffee machine.
Convenient Location
Located in the Dominion, just 1.8 km from Six Flags Fiesta Texas, this hotel is situated in a prime location. Guests can easily access The Shops at La Cantera, which are only 3.2 km away, and San Antonio International Airport is a short 15 km drive from the property.
Exceptional Service
With a 24-hour front desk and a mini-market on-site, the Hilton Garden Inn ensures that guests have everything they need for a comfortable stay. Plus, with free WiFi access and parking, guests can relax and enjoy their time at this exceptional hotel.

Guests must be 18 or older to book.
Guests are required to show a photo identification and credit card upon check-in. Please note that all Special Requests are subject to availability and additional charges may apply.
Public parking is possible on site (reservation is not needed) and costs USD 10 per day.
WiFi is available in all areas and is free of charge.
Pets are not allowed.
When booking more than 9 rooms, different policies and additional supplements may apply.
Children of any age are allowed.
Children up to and including 3 years old stay for US$15 per person per night when using an available cot.
Children up to and including 17 years old stay for free when using an existing bed.
You haven't added any extra beds.
Any type of extra bed or child's cot/crib is upon request and needs to be confirmed by management.
Supplements are not calculated automatically in the total costs and will have to be paid for separately during your stay.
